What is Codien?
您的團隊是否正苦於耗時費力、且容易出錯的傳統測試套件現代化任務? Codien 是一個由 AI 驅動的平台,專為開發人員和 QA 團隊設計,能自動將 Protractor 和 Selenium 測試轉換為簡潔、現代化的 Playwright 程式碼。它能為您省下數週的人工作業時間,並確保順暢、精確地轉換至更高效能的測試框架。
主要功能
🤖 智慧測試轉換 Codien 運用先進的 AI 引擎,能以 98% 的準確率,自動將您的整個測試套件從 Protractor 或 Selenium 轉換為 Playwright。它智慧地保留核心測試邏輯、選擇器(selectors)和斷言(assertions),有效免除了手動重寫的需求,並確保功能一致性。
✍️ 自然語言測試撰寫 只需用簡單的英文描述所需步驟,即可建立全新的 Playwright 測試。Codien 的 AI 能解讀您的指令並生成相對應的測試程式碼,讓測試建立變得前所未有的快速,並且對所有團隊成員來說,無論其技術深淺,都能輕鬆上手。
↔️ 互動式並排編輯器 讓您對整個遷移過程擁有完整的透明度和控制權。Codien 將您的原始傳統程式碼與全新、AI 生成的 Playwright 程式碼並排呈現。這讓您能在最終確定測試前,即時比較、優化並驗證轉換結果。
📊 全面性遷移儀表板 從單一、高階的視圖,管理您的整個遷移作業。該儀表板可讓您組織多個專案、透過詳細的分析數據追蹤轉換進度,並監控每個測試檔案的狀態,讓您從頭到尾都能完全掌握並掌控全局。
Codien 如何解決您的問題:
Codien 旨在解決測試工作流程現代化過程中,所面臨的特定且實際的挑戰。
您仍受困於已被棄用的框架: 如果您的團隊仍在延用 Protractor,您正走向一條死胡同。Codien 提供一條直接、自動化的前進道路,只需輕輕一點,即可將整個 Protractor 套件轉換為 Playwright,同時保留原始的資料夾結構和測試邏輯。
您的 Selenium 測試既複雜又緩慢: 儘管功能強大,Selenium 程式碼卻可能變得冗長且難以維護。Codien 將這些複雜性轉化為簡潔、快速且現代化的 Playwright 測試,這些測試利用 async/await 模式和 Playwright 的自動等待功能,以實現更穩定、更具可讀性的程式碼。
手動遷移風險過高且成本昂貴: 手動重寫數百個測試不僅緩慢,更會大量耗費開發人員資源,並引入人為錯誤的風險。Codien 將此過程自動化,交付一致且高品質的程式碼,讓您的團隊能專注於開發新功能,而非重複撰寫測試。
為何選擇 Codien?
Playwright 是現代端到端測試的絕佳目標,但它並不會為您遷移舊有測試。這正是 Codien 填補的關鍵空白。它不僅僅是一個程式碼編輯器;它是一個專門的遷移引擎,能理解傳統框架的細微差別。
Codien 扮演著智慧橋樑的角色,自動處理那些原本需要手動完成的關鍵轉換:
將 Selenium 選擇器轉換為 Playwright 定位器(locators)。
轉換 Protractor 針對 Angular 的特定語法。
更新 同步程式碼為現代的 async/await 模式。
以 Playwright 強大的自動等待機制取代脆弱的手動等待。
基本上,Codien 為您完成了繁瑣複雜的工作,讓您無需操心。
結論:
對於尋求高效且可靠地現代化測試工作流程的工程團隊而言,Codien 絕對是最佳工具。它消除了導入 Playwright 的主要障礙——即手動、耗時的傳統測試套件轉換過程。透過自動化遷移,Codien 讓您的團隊能夠自信且快速地採納現代測試實踐。
立即探索 Codien 如何加速您向 Playwright 的轉變!





